The scene on this vase shows a later moment in the myth of Danaë and Perseus. Having been warned by an oracle that his grandson would kill him, Akrisios locked Danaë and her young son in a chest and set it afloat. Danaë and Perseus sit in the open chest while Akrisios, a young girl and a maidservant bid farewell.

“The Process was eventually refined and became known as black-figure pottery after 600 BC, the archaic age. Notable for their black figures and usually orange backgrounds and greater attention to detail, as well as a focus on humans. Sometimes, white was used as a third color.”
